It's a huge rivalry for them. Ole Miss fans want to beat them, but we could care less.

Ole Miss has owned the series historically: 49-11-2. Ole Miss has struggled with Memphis when the Tigers have a good team though. When Memphis has at least 8 wins, they are 4-6-1 against the Rebs (dating back to 1960).
